I was supposed to have cleaned out our entryway and put in a landing strip. Instead, I tried to design it and until I had more time. While doing some research, I came across this picture from Real Simple Magazine’s website. I liked the idea of having peg rails to hold an assortment of items, from bags, to umbrellas.

I spent some time sketching out some ideas for a landing strip and a coat hanging area, consulting my better half along the way (he’s a tough critic, you know).
We bought two peg rails from the Container Store that will stretch from the door to the end of the wall. Tig’s Paris photo is going to hang above it to take the attention off the pegs and coats. We’ll continue to look for a bench to hold our bags and shoes.
Today, I primed the peg rails while I was working on another project.
